Post by: bbfsouthwind on June 16, 2009, 12:27:02 PM
I personally would not run a gear drive in any of my engines. One of the reasons is that the gears will transfer alot of harmonics from the rotating assembly to your valvetrain, wich you do not want. A big advantage of running a timing belt versus a chain is that alot of the harmonics are absorbed by the belt and not transfered. In my opinion the gear drive is a cave mans technology way of cam timing. Oh and i dont really think you will hear the noise of the gears over the headers.
